如何在Visual Paradigm中创建逻辑架构图

在软件开发过程中,逻辑架构图是展示系统组成部分及其相互关系的重要工具。其能够帮助团队理解系统的结构,促进沟通与协作。对于一个刚入行的小白,了解如何使用Visual Paradigm(VP)创建逻辑架构图至关重要。本文将为你提供一个详细的步骤指导,并附上相应的代码示例。

流程概览

以下是创建逻辑架构图的基本流程:

步骤 描述
1 安装Visual Paradigm
2 创建新项目
3 添加逻辑架构图
4 设计图形元素
5 保存与导出图形

详细步骤

1. 安装Visual Paradigm

首先,你需要从[Visual Paradigm官网]( Paradigm。选择符合你操作系统的版本,然后按照指示完成安装。

2. 创建新项目

安装完成后,打开Visual Paradigm,选择“新建项目”。在弹出的窗口中,你可以为你的项目设置一个合适的名称和目录。

// 在Visual Paradigm中,点击“新建项目”按钮,输入项目名称
// 例如:My Logic Architecture

3. 添加逻辑架构图

在创建项目后,选择“图表”。然后在选择图表类型时,选择“逻辑架构图”。

// 在工具栏中选择“图表”实例 -> “逻辑架构图”
// 右击并选择“添加图表”,然后选择“逻辑架构图”

4. 设计图形元素

在逻辑架构图中,你可以使用各种图形元素来表示系统组件和它们之间的关系。这些元素包括框、箭头、组件、接口等。以下是如何使用这些元素的说明:

  • 添加组件:使用“组件”工具,在画布上点击以添加组件。

    // 使用组件工具添加组件,例如“用户界面”、“服务层”
    
  • 添加接口:使用“接口”工具,连接组件之间的接口。

    // 使用接口工具连接两个组件,例如从“用户界面”到“服务层”
    
  • 添加关系:使用箭头工具,绘制表示关系的箭头。

    // 使用箭头工具画出组件之间的关系,例如“用户界面”调用“服务层”
    

在此步骤中,你可以设置不同的颜色和线条样式来区分不同的组件类型和关系。

5. 保存与导出图形

完成设计后,别忘了保存你的工作。在工具栏中点击“文件”,选择“保存”或“另存为”。

// 在文件菜单中选择“保存”,确保所有更改都被记录

此外,你还可以导出图形为PNG、JPEG等格式,方便分享或在文档中使用。

// 选择“文件” -> “导出”,选择所需的格式进行导出

MRmaid旅行图示例

为了帮助你更好地理解整个流程,我为你设计了一幅旅行图,展示了上述步骤的逻辑关系。

journey
    title 创建逻辑架构图的流程
    section 步骤
      安装Visual Paradigm: 5: 开发者
      创建新项目: 4: 开发者
      添加逻辑架构图: 3: 开发者
      设计图形元素: 2: 开发者
      保存与导出图形: 5: 开发者

完整代码示例

在设计逻辑架构图时,你可能需要写一些简单的伪代码来帮助理解组件之间的关系。以下是一个基本的伪代码示例:

class UserInterface {
    ServiceLayer serviceLayer;
    
    void userRequest() {
        serviceLayer.processRequest(this);
    }
}

class ServiceLayer {
    void processRequest(UserInterface ui) {
        // 处理用户请求的逻辑
    }
}

在这个示例中,UserInterface 类与 ServiceLayer 类之间的关系通过依赖关系表达出来。UserInterface 类调用 ServiceLayer 类的方法来处理请求。

结语

通过上述的步骤与示例,相信你已经对如何在Visual Paradigm中创建逻辑架构图有了一定的了解。逻辑架构图不仅帮助开发者理清思路,也能让团队成员在项目讨论中有效沟通。随着你经验的积累,你可以尝试在图形中加入更多复杂的元素和关系,以提高图形的表达能力。希望你在学习和使用Visual Paradigm的过程中能够越来越得心应手!